This role, in particular, will be focused on “integration” activities, helping to lead up our Product Development track supporting our own APIs as well as the integration of third-party tools and APIs to extend the capabilities of our platform.\n\nEssential Duties & Responsibilities\n\n\n* Work closely with application teams, subject matter experts, and third-party application experts to determine the business needs for interfaces, document the requirements, and configure the interfaces per the requirements.\n\n* Provide proactive support by monitoring live interfaces and collaborating with experts to provide permanent resolutions to problems\n\n* Support, troubleshoot, upgrade, and audit the interface engine.\n\n* Research technical, interface and integration problems and routinely apply troubleshooting and problem-solving skills\n\n* Create and maintain flat file pass-through for third-party entities.\n\n* Maintain detailed architectural documentation for all deployed interfaces.\n\n* Assist in development, writing and testing of various clinical, financial and quality reports\n\n* Manage the flow of information between internal and external customers.\n\n* Maintain concurrence of HL7 standards and translation requirements.\n\n* Perform other duties as assigned.\n\n\n\n\nRequirements:\n\n\n* 5 years’ experience creating and maintaining HL7 interfaces.\n\n* Working knowledge of HL7 version 2.x message types and segment/field mapping (ADT, ORM, ORU, DFT, MDM, etc.).\n\n* Proficient healthcare data exchange formats such as XML, CCD, CDA and DICOM as well healthcare data standards such as LOINC, CPT, ICD-9/ICD-10, and SNOMED\n\n* Proficient with Postgres SQL or other SQL databases\n\n* Working knowledge of TCP/IP security, networking, and data transport methods.\n\n* Ability to problem solve/troubleshoot interface issues through research.\n\n* Ability to review specifications and architect interfaces based on their design\n\n\n \n\n#Salary and compensation\n
